Brian, I agree with you on the trailing hash requirement. DNA will not make a match for you unless you typed the hash at the end.
[image: Inline image 1] [image: Inline image 2] Also, the PreDot/Trailing # is only needed for Translation Patterns. Route Patterns strip the trailing hash automatically. Though, it doesn't hurt to use the predot/trailing # on Route Patterns, it will still work.
